Ship Loading Systems: Secure and Reliable Liquid Discharge for Ships
Bottom loading arms provide a vital system for the safe and efficient transfer of liquids between ships and shore-based facilities. These specialized pieces of equipment are designed to withstand the rigors of marine environments, ensuring reliable operation even in challenging conditions. Furthermore, bottom loading arms incorporate various safety features, such as pressure relief valves and interlocking mechanisms, to prevent spills, leaks, and other potential hazards. Their robust construction and advanced design make them the preferred choice for a wide range of liquid cargo applications, from fuel oil and chemicals to foodstuffs and farming products.
- Fundamental traits of bottom loading arms include:
- Sturdy construction materials to withstand corrosion and impact
- Precise flow control mechanisms for safe and efficient transfer
- Built-in safety features to prevent leaks, spills, and overfilling
- Automatic locking systems to secure connections during transfer
Types of Marine Loading Arms: A Comprehensive Guide
Loading arms are essential components in the marine marketplace for transferring liquids and gases between vessels and shore facilities. These complex systems ensure efficient and safe cargo handling, but with various types available, navigating the options can be tricky. This comprehensive guide delves into the different types of marine loading arms, outlining their functions and common applications.
- Swivel-Joint Loading Arms: Known for their flexibility, swivel-joint arms allow for rotation to accommodate vessel positioning. They are commonly used in loading oil, chemicals, and other materials.
- Telescopic Loading Arms: These arms feature extendable components, enabling them to reach a wider range of vessels. They are often deployed for loading or unloading large quantities of cargo, such as crude oil or refined products.
- Flexible Hose Loading Arms: Composed of flexible hoses, these arms offer high flexibility. They are ideal for applications involving tight spaces or irregular vessel movements.
Understanding the distinct characteristics and applications of each type of marine loading arm is crucial for selecting the optimal solution for specific operational needs. Marine Loading and Unloading Arm Technology Evolution
Over the past century, marine loading and unloading arm technology has undergone a significant transformation. Initially, these arms were chiefly manual operations, demanding considerable manpower to transport cargo. However, with the progress of electrical and mechanical systems, marine loading and unloading arms have become more and more automated. This evolution has led to significant improvements in output, safety, and general capability.
Contemporary marine loading and unloading arms are furnished with a wide range of features, such as automated systems, obstacle recognition systems, and teleoperation functions. This continuous evolution is fueled by the demand for more ,effective and ,trustworthy operations in the ever-growing global shipping industry.
